### Key Differences Between Suspended and Floor-Mounted Heaters
While both types of heaters use infrared technology to warm objects rather than air, they differ in how they’re installed and used. Floor-mounted heaters, like the popular Sunglo models, are portable and can be moved around as needed. However, they take up valuable floor space and may need to be repositioned frequently.
Suspended heaters, on the other hand, are mounted overhead and remain fixed in place. This allows for more efficient use of floor space, especially in commercial settings where maximizing seating is crucial. They also tend to be more energy-efficient since they don’t require constant movement.
### Are You Limited by Floor Space?
If you have limited floor space, suspended heaters can be a game-changer. They don't occupy any ground area, allowing you to make the most of your outdoor layout. Whether you're running a restaurant or hosting friends at home, this can make a big difference in how you use your space.
### Do You Have an Overhang?
Suspended heaters work best when installed under a sturdy overhang, such as a veranda or gazebo. This not only protects the unit from weather but also enhances the overall aesthetic of the space. For example, the Sunglo model offers a stylish alternative to traditional mushroom heaters, mounted from above.
### What Fuel Options Are Available?
Mushroom heaters typically run on propane or natural gas, making them easy to move and install. Suspended heaters, however, are usually powered by electricity or natural gas. This makes them ideal for permanent installations, as they don’t require a base for fuel storage.
